William Morris at Home William Morris Brother Rabbit Sage - WallpaperAlthough Morris regularly used birds in his designs, Brother Rabbit is his only repeating pattern to feature an animal. Designed in 1882, the design was originally created using wood blocks, which are now in the collection of the William Morris Gallery. Morris's skilled team of printers would use up to 25 blocks per design in order to create his dense patterns. Brother Rabbit Sage wallpaper features beautifully entwined leaves and trees in cream and deep mustard yellow, with accents of light blush pink.
